A light earthquake with magnitude 4.7 (ml/mb) was reported South Sandwich Islands region (0 miles) on Thursday. Exact time and date of earthquake 01/05/25 / 2025-05-01 02:00:18 / May 1, 2025 @ 2:00 am UTC/GMT. The earthquake occurred at a depth of 10 km (6 miles). All ids that are associated to the event: us7000pzkm. Unique identifier: us7000pzkm. Exact location, longitude -28.6104° West, latitude -60.3748° South, depth = 10 km. The temblor was reported at 02:00:18 / 2:00 am (local time epicenter). A tsunami warning has not been issued (Does not indicate if a tsunami actually did or will exist).
Earthquakes 4.0 to 5.0 are often felt, but only causes minor damage. In the past 24 hours, there have been two, in the last 10 days two, in the past 30 days three and in the last 365 days twenty-four earthquakes of magnitude 3.0 or greater that have been detected nearby. Each year there are an estimated 13,000 light earthquakes in the world.
